Sr Demand Content Writer

Docker is a remote first company with employees across Europe and the Americas that simplifies the lives of developers who are making world-changing apps.  We raised our Series C funding in March 2022 for $105M at a $2.1B valuation. We continued to see exponential revenue growth last year.  Join us for a whale of a ride!

Summary of the role:

We are looking for a storyteller who is equal parts journalist, content marketer, and copywriter to join our Growth Marketing team. In this role, you will ideate on and create content and copy tailored for developer audiences and marketing delivery channels. 

To thrive in this role, you’ll need an interest and ideally some technical knowledge of developer tools, you’ll need to understand how growth marketing and demand generation work, and you’ll need a relentless drive to try new things with an eye for detail. Your long-term success will depend on your ability to work closely with internal teams at Docker, who will help amplify and optimize your marketing content. Most importantly, you’ll need to be okay with taking ownership of big objectives with big goals, working autonomously, and maintaining a bias for considered action.

Why this is a great opportunity: 

  • Join one of the best known brands in the developer ecosystem!

  • Work with one of the best and most engaged user bases on the planet.

  • Create, own, and execute campaign content to accelerate product usage, drive engagement, and build pipeline. 

  • Directly impact the results and performance of growth marketing programs executed globally to help users engage with and be successful with Docker.

Responsibilities:

  • Influence and collaborate with multiple stakeholders from sales, developer relations, product marketing, web, events, design, and marketing operations to generate compelling content to targeted personas throughout the user lifecycle.

  • Work across channels to create compelling content that reach our audiences where they are including: community forums, email, digital ads, video, web, in-product, virtual and in-person events, and other demand focused channels.

  • Work with Campaign Managers to a/b test content messaging and asset formats

Qualifications

  • 8 - 10 years of professional writing and editing experience especially in SaaS or  B2B/B2C software marketing campaigns.

  • Impeccable writing and editing skills (please share your portfolio or 3-5 writing/editing samples – can be editorial or brand journalism)

  •  Strong editorial judgment; ability to rapidly absorb complex ideas and distill them into accessible copy for global audiences

  • Strong interest in the developer space and developer tools.

  • Excellent communication skills (many of your interactions will be remote)

  • Ability to confidently and tactfully engage with engineers and subject-matter experts; skill at achieving consensus and moving projects forward

  • Exceptional organizational skills; ability to handle multiple projects simultaneously, manage complex processes, and meet both short-term and long-term deadlines

What to expect in the first 30 days:

  • Get to know the team, product, and our key personas.

  • Develop a content strategy and process.

What to expect in the first 90 days:

  • Contribute meaningfully to an existing campaign.

  • Build consensus around new content strategies with relevant stakeholders on developer relations, customer success, operations, and product marketing.

  • Develop a comprehensive understanding of our key personas, pain points, and opportunities.
